Video Tutorial With Text Instructions Below

Your notification settings are accessed by clicking on your login initials (or photo) in the upper right corner of the Govly Dashboard and selecting "Profile" as shown here:

Select the "Edit" icon in the upper right-hand corner of the next page that appears.

After clicking the "Edit" button, you'll be directed to a new page where you'll be able to edit your notification settings. You may have to scroll down to view the information shown below.

Digest notifications are single emails that have links back to Govly for the events that triggered the notifications. These are sent either hourly or daily, with daily being sent around 7am Eastern time for event notifications covering the prior 24 hours. Here is what a portion of a digest email looks like:

The digest email will show the account, the event that triggered the notification, and a link back to Govly for the opportunity that caused the notification. 

NOTE: You can select instant notification for any of the events shown two images above. If you have either Hourly or Daily digest selected along the top, all events will also arrive in a digest email. The digest emails are either all or none, as you cannot select individual events for digest or not. If you do not want to receive digest emails at all, simply select "Never" at the top.

There is one other place to check your notifications, at least those associated with opportunities you have been assigned to work or are following via the Subscribe function. Notifications for these opportunity-related events (all shown in Notification Settings except "When you have a new saved search match an opportunity") are also placed in the Notifications page in Govly, which is viewed by clicking on your initials in the upper right side of the Govly Dashboard, then selecting "Notification".

You will then see notifications related to opportunities you have been assigned to work or are following via the Subscribe function.

One final note on Notifications. You will not receive notifications for events that you trigger yourself. In other words, if you are the one changing a pipeline stage, you will not be notified of the change. If someone other than you that is subscribed or assigned to an opportunity makes a change, you will receive the notification (provided your profile is set up to do so as described above) but the person who made the change will not.
